The Advantest TQ82014 is a single-channel optical power sensor designed as a plug-in accessory for Advantest optical power meters and spectrum analyzers. It extends measurement capability across the visible and near-infrared spectrum, enabling precise optical power characterization in telecommunications, laser printing, optical storage, and R&D environments. The sensor employs a silicon photodiode with onboard wavelength sensitivity compensation, delivering direct absolute power readings with 0.01 dB resolution across a dynamic range spanning six decades.
– Technical Specifications
• Wavelength Range: 0.4 µm to 1.1 µm
• Power Range: 0.001 µW to 50 mW (−70 dBm to +17 dBm)
• Power Resolution: 0.01 dB
• Measurement Accuracy: ±5% nominal; ±3.0% at 780 nm (0 dBm) and ±0.20 dB at 1 mW over 23±3°C; ±4.0% at 780 nm (0 dBm) and ±0.20 dB at 1 mW over 0–40°C
• Detector: Silicon photodiode
• Operating Environment: 0–40°C, 4–85% RH
• Storage Temperature: −25–70°C
• Dimensions: 90(W) × 94(H) × 6(D) mm
• Mass: ≤110 g
– Key Features
• Wavelength sensitivity data stored in onboard memory enables automatic compensation when wavelength is set
• Single-channel architecture optimized for OPM/OSA integration
• Wide dynamic range measurement from microwatt to tens-of-milliwatt levels
• Sub-0.01 dB resolution supports precision characterization of laser and optical component performance
• Silicon photodiode provides flat spectral response across visible and near-IR bands

– Compatibility & Integration
The TQ82014 connects directly to Advantest TQ8210, TQ8215, Q8214A, and Q8210 optical power meters, as well as select Advantest spectrum analyzers. Wavelength sensitivity at 400 nm may degrade under high-humidity conditions; use in other bands is unaffected by ambient moisture.
